On Thu, Oct 12, 2006 at 11:59:00PM +0100, Dominic Bishop wrote:
I am running a RELENG_6 from yesterday on amd64 and the VIA PATA
controller is being detected as GENERIC ATA, from dmesg:

atapci0: <GENERIC ATA controller> port
0x1f0-0x1f7,0x3f6,0x170-0x177,0x376,0xfc00-0xfc0f at device 15.0 on pci0

uname -a:
FreeBSD 6.2-PRERELEASE FreeBSD 6.2-PRERELEASE #0: Wed Oct 11 22:10:03 UTC
2006 :/usr/obj/usr/src/sys/PPV1 amd64

The kernel config is simply a generic kernel with SMP, device polling and
geli/crypto added to it.

The device in question from pciconf -lv:

atapci0@pci0:15:0: class=0x01018a card=0x81b51043 chip=0x05711106
rev=0x07 hdr=0x00
vendor = 'VIA Technologies Inc'
device = 'VT82xxxx EIDE Controller (All VIA Chipsets)'
class = mass storage
subclass = ATA

Unfortunately I cannot say what motherboard is in the machine as it is a
leased dedicated server.

My system shows the same PATA controller;

atapci1@pci0:15:1: class=0x01018a card=0x80ed1043 chip=0x05711106 rev=0x06
hdr=0x00
vendor = 'VIA Technologies Inc'
device = 'VT82xxxx EIDE Controller (All VIA Chipsets)'
class = mass storage
subclass = ATA

The only difference is that your chipset has a higher revision number.

But it is recognized without problems:

atapci1: <VIA 8237 UDMA133 controller> port
0x1f0-0x1f7,0x3f6,0x170-0x177,0x376,0xfc00-0xfc0f at device 15.1 on pci0
